Background of Bilbao
one. Before its founding (third century BC – 1299)
Even though the official heritage of Bilbao begins in 1300, the world was inhabited extended right before then.
Archaeological excavations have uncovered human remains courting back again towards the 3rd century BC in the area round the estuary and the Previous City.
Prior to starting to be a city, there was a little fishing village Found on the financial institutions with the Nervión River, where by the 7 Streets would afterwards arise.
The standard etymology of Bilbao is frequently connected to Bi Albo (“two financial institutions”), alluding to the two sides in the estuary.
2. Formal founding (1300)
On June fifteen, 1300, Diego López V de Haro, Lord of Biscay, granted the town charter that founded the city of Bilbao.
The municipal coat of arms retains The 2 wolves on the Haro lineage.
The inspiration sought to:
• Consolidate a industrial port around the estuary.
• Manage the iron targeted traffic from the Biscayan ironworks.
• Create an city center protected by partitions.
3. Medieval Business Bilbao (14th–16th Hundreds of years)
Its strategic locale around the estuary permitted Bilbao to quickly become a critical commercial Middle to the Cantabrian coast.
Milestones:
• Advancement with the port, among the busiest in the Middle Ages.
• In 1511, the Consulate of Bilbao was made, an institution that regulated maritime trade and the maintenance with the estuary.
• Enlargement from the Seven Streets being an city Centre.
The iron trade and also the export of Castilian wool have been critical drivers.
4. Money of Biscay (1602)
In 1602, Bilbao was named the funds of Biscay, displacing Bermeo.
This consolidated its political and financial job. 5. Industrial Bilbao (18th–19th Centuries)
The commercial Revolution radically remodeled the town:
• Significant iron ore mining in the nearby mountains.
• Establishment of shipyards, steelworks, and factories alongside the estuary.
• Arrival on the railway and concrete enlargement to Abando.
• Immediate population growth.
Bilbao became among Spain's industrial powerhouses.
6. Carlist Wars and Destruction (19th Century)
Bilbao endured numerous Carlist sieges, particularly in 1835–36 and 1874.
Even with this, the town resisted and strengthened its liberal and business identification.
seven. Growth and Modernization (Late 19th–Early 20th Centuries)
The Abando Expansion (1876) marks the birth of modern Bilbao:
• Wide streets and rational style.
• Construction of the City Corridor, Arriaga Theatre, and La Concordia Station.
• The emergence of banking companies and corporations that could completely transform Bilbao right into a fiscal Middle.
8. 20th Century: Industry, War, and Reconstruction
Civil War (1936–1937)
Bilbao falls in June 1937. Town suffers bombing and destruction, but maintains its industrial foundation.
2nd fifty percent from the 20th century
• Bilbao results in being the financial funds of northern Spain.
• The estuary is severely polluted by business.
• Industrial disaster during the seventies–eighties: closures, unemployment, and urban drop.
nine. The Great Transformation (1990–present)
Within the nineties onward, Bilbao started Just about the most admired urban transformations in the world:
Critical assignments:
• Guggenheim Museum Bilbao (1997), a symbol of city renaissance.
• Regeneration of Abandoibarra.
• Thorough cleanup in the estuary.
• Bilbao Metro (Norman Foster).
• Euskalduna Palace.
• Zorrozaurre as a upcoming Innovative hub.
Bilbao is transforming from an industrial town into a town of expert services, tradition, and architecture.
ten. Bilbao Nowadays
Based on the latest knowledge, Bilbao is projected to possess 351,124 inhabitants in 2025. It is actually a modern, ground breaking metropolis with a strong cultural identification, combining:
• Basque custom.
• Industrial heritage.
• Up to date architecture.
• An economic climate based upon solutions, society, and engineering.
